So what I did tonight is this: I roasted some of the amazing pre-cut Butternut Squash I got this week (thank you again, Trader Joe's!.) When they were finished, I toasted a slice of wheat bread. While the bread was toasting, I fork-mashed the butternut squash, and mixed it into some delicious cream cheese. I put some of this squash-cheese between the two halves of the toasted wheat bread and viola! A tasty veggie infused cousin of the grilled cheese that Elliot loves with all his heart and soul.
